text: Sree Narayana Polytechnic College (Malayalam: ശ്രീ നാരായണ പോളിടെക് നിക്ക് is located in Kottiyam near Kollam, Kerala in southern India. It is named after the Saint and social reformer "Sree Narayana Guru". SNPTC was founded in 1957, by the Sree Narayana Trusts, Kollam under the initiative of the secretary, the late Sri.R.Sankar, former chief minister of Kerala.
